Game Review

The Blues were supreme in this match, mainly off the back of 3 key midfielders in their prime - Brett Ratten, Anthony Koutoufides and Scott Camporeale. They would have 34, 33 and 30 possessions respectively, and have a fair few shots on goal (Kouta 4.3; Ratten 0.4) as the Blues danced away from the Dockers at Subiaco. Kouta, in particular was in a run of good form.

The Blues rucking due of Matthew Allan and Trent Hotton would take the honours over Clem Michael (remember him?) and Justin Longmuir, whilst Lance Whitnall would continue his fine 2000 form with 19 possessions, 9 marks and 2 goals. Clive Waterhouse kicked 6 for the losers.

After the win, Carlton were equal second but 3 games behind ladder-leading and all-conquering Essendon.
